Sam Burns closed with a 67 to reach 22-under and win at the Sanderson Farms Championship on Sunday. This second PGA Tour title follows his win at the Valspar Championship in the spring

Burns shot three birdies and a bogey on the front nine to make the turn in 34 and took the lead with birdies at the 11th and 13th before making two more at the 14th and 15th. He found the greeside bunker at 18 and with a two shot lead took a safe bogey for the win.

Nick Watney produced a bogey-free 65, his best finish in over three years, to take a share of second place at 21-under alongside Cameron Young (68).

"I'm working on a lot of things," said Watney. "I'm back with Butch [Harmon], I love him, and so I'm working on my swing with him. I'm working on my mental game just trying to be really, really honest and authentic with myself."

Sweden's Henrik Norlander joins the all-American top-7 in a share of fourth place at 20-under after a bogey-free 64.

"I'm pretty pleased," said Norlander. "I told myself, try to get to 20-under. I felt like I played really well yesterday and just sort of stalled out in the middle of the back nine. And I made two really bad bogeys on 15 and 16. And I don't know, I just felt like I've been playing really good all week and I made some really good putts today and hit a lot of great iron shots and hit a great putt on the last just went the other way.

"I just had five weeks off and I set a plan, I'm just sort of tired of not really getting all out of my game. I feel like I'm playing pretty well all last year and I ended up finishing 93rd on the FedExCup. So I just put a plan together and really executed at home the last two weeks, a lot of wedges, a lot of putting a lot of short game, areas where I've been struggling, and wasn't expecting to get results right away, but I hit better wedges than I ever have this week, so it's nice to get sort of some receipt on a good work. So I'm really excited going forward this fall."

Hayden Buckley (66) and Trey Mullinax, both bogey-free, as well as Andrew Landry (66) join Norlander in fourth place.

Californian PGA Tour rookie Sahith Theegala who held the 54-hole lead shot three birdies to make the turn in 33 but three bogeys over the next four holes put paid to his chances at the title. He made another birdie at the 14th and parred the final four holes to close with a 71 and finished T8 at 19-under.

"It was a fantastic week," said Theegala. "I played some really good golf and just a little unfortunate how that sort of that back nine is, but it's my first one and first time really being in that position, so I'm obviously going to learn a lot and just take so many positives away and even the last few holes there I was proud of myself how I held it in there making a couple pars after I was already kind of out of contention, but overall fantastic week and just want to thank Steve Jent tournament director, he's putting on a great event and just glad I could come back.
